Rock and Roll Hall of Fame inductee Gene Simmons made an appearance inside Mandalay Bay’s Crossroads at House of Blues to introduce bands from the Gene Simmons Rock ‘n’ Roll Fantasy Camp on Saturday night. Known for his iconic black and white makeup and extravagant costumes, the KISS singer and bassist warmed the crowded venue with a few jokes. The audience erupted in applause when Simmons mentioned KISS will tour with fellow rock band Def Leppard this summer.

Rock ‘n’ Roll Fantasy Camp provides music fans the opportunity to jam with legendary rock stars, write and record original songs, participate in master classes and perform live on stage in front of friends and family at Crossroads at House of Blues. Mandalay Bay and Crossroads at House of Blues will host the Blues Fantasy Camp April 10-13.
